CMAA GOLD COAST 20TH ANNIVERSARY Fillies and Mares Class 1 Handicap 1100m

Track: SOFT 5   Rain (Max: 27)   Rail: +5m 1000m-400m; +2m Remainder.. (Pent: 4.81)  

Rafale Jolie to take charge ahead of Miss Dramatic at a strong tempo. Gollan-trained MEHRETU (1) missed a whisker first-up at Doomben off a trial win at the track. She further improved and has a 1.5kg claim and an inside gates. Strips fitter and rates to go one better. Stablemate IMMEDIATE (2) placed at Ipswich building on her 3L all-the-way win at Ipswich in Maidens. Peaks today and can make the finish. KAHLUA GIRL (7) was spelled off a Doomben Maiden win and was well supported at Gatton first up and may not have appreciated the tight turning track. Has the ability and can improve quickly. CAXTON LASS (4) is third-up and ready to show his best. Will get a soft run from the inside gate and deserves consideration. CHILPUR (5) resumed at Gatton and spaced the Maidens from the front. Fitter and is sure to give a sight. SUGGESTED PLAY: Backing Mehretu.
